Sky Sports has revamped its website in a bid to encourage more user interaction.The new look skysports.com homepage features more stories and headlines than before and a 'breaking news' ticker, similar to the one used on the Sky Sports News channel, has been introduced.
Sky's presenters and studio guests will contribute to various sporting debates and there will be a more interviews with talent and blogs from sporting personalities.
More downloadable content has also been added to the site. These include clips and highlights from Sky Sports shows such as Soccer Saturdayand Boots n' All.
In addition, viewers can now access Sky Sports programming information online for the first time. This includes highlighted sections such as picks of the day.
Sky+ customers can use the site to set their set-top boxes remotely to record shows.
Viewers can now also submit blogs, contribute to forums and participate in polls.
